Hey Guys i've been thinking of investing in a 14' jonboat and turning it into a bass boat for quite some time now, and i finally am getting serious about it. Some of my concerns are...
-is it possible to get a 14' jon boat with a consule, or can i make a custom made consule?
I want to equip it with hydraulic steering, a bow mount trolling motor,aerated livewell,plenty of storage,and a used outboard, which i am still searching for. I dont want to spend over $1000 if possible on the jon boat. All help is appreciated.Really want it to have a consule though if possible.

You can get Jon Boats with consoles, which in itself pisses your budget away. If you're planning on adding an outboard, and keeping it forever, you'll want to get a welded boat. Riveted boats are fine for trolling use, no slapping the water, but there goes your budget again :)
